What significance is crossing over for evolution of a species?
suter [353]

Crossing over is a process that happens between homologous chromosomes in order to increase genetic diversity. During crossing over, part of one chromosome is exchanged with another.

Give two advantages that cells gain by storing energy in the form of ATP
BARSIC [14]

ATP is a small molecule used in cells as a co enzyme. It is often referred to as the molecular unit of currency of intra cellular energy transfer and is critically involved in maintaining cell structure.

Extra cellular ATP is a signalling molecule , and also important in signal transduction processes.

It is important in the synthesis of RNA and DNA. Amino acid activation during protein synthesis also uses ATP as an energy source.
